Does Mandala Have To Be a Circle : A Mandala is a sacred, often circular, design. The word mandala derives from a sanscrit word meaning circle. While mandalas are most often rounded or circular (i.e., more symmetrical), this is not necessarily the case.

Defining the Term Mandala

Deriving from the ancient Sanskrit word for “circle”, at first glance mandala connotes roundness. But read deeper. Originally signifying “containment”, “essence” or “wholeness”, metaphysical manda denotes a conduit of cosmic forces – the circle channeling a deity’s power outward. What matters more than circular boundaries? The power-bestowed patterns inside.

Purpose and Function Over Form 

In Eastern religions, creating complex geometric mandala diagrams serves various functions:

Guiding meditation via focal beauty

Mapping internal psychological aspects  

Symbolizing the divine realm

Modeling balance and unity

 Providing a sacred site for ceremonies

Note the consistent emphasis on purpose and unity above pure aesthetics. Any coherent design radiating harmoniously from the center outward directs awareness accordingly.

Broadening Shape Interpretations 

Given the significance of organized motifs over dimensions, mandalas logically needn’t be confined to circles. Consider:

Square mandalas in Tibetan traditions represent stabilized wisdom

Triangular compositions inspire an upward spiritual focus 

Rectilinear patterns align directionally across altar spaces

Ornate filigrees as framing devices concentrate attention

Multi-sided graphics or textures serve equivalent psychological functions as circular medallions in guiding mindfulness if organized symmetrically with clear focal points. Craft according to the desired effect.
